About Stevenage
In the county of Hertfordshire, Stevenage is sandwiched between Letchworth Garden City and Welwyn Garden City. Stevenage is just 33 miles from Central London, and at peak times there are up to eight trains an hour into the capital, as well as services to Cambridge and Leeds.
What’s more, the A1 runs past the town and London Luton Airport is only a 30-minute drive. This is a town that’s perfectly located for anyone keen to be close to London and other South East centres.
Within Stevenage is Fairlands Valley Park, a 120-acre green site complete with a lake offering water sports, abseiling and climbing, and the town also has a Leisure Park with numerous restaurants.
The Stevenage area is host to over 70 areas of open space and nearly 40 wildlife sites. Fairlands Valley Park is a 120-acre green site offering water sports, abseiling and climbing.
Alternatively, relax in the gardens at Hampson Park while the kids burn off energy in the play area or on the BMX track.
